"Learn to build real AI prototypes without writing a single line of code using ChatGPT, Microsoft AI Builder, Vertex AI, DataRobot, and Notion AI. This course equips you with practical skills to translate business problems into working AI solutions through no-code platforms and advanced prompt engineering.

In Module 1, you'll learn to frame business challenges as AI problems, map tasks to model types, and create solution blueprints with workflows and KPIs. Module 2 takes you hands-on β€” building sentiment analysis, forecasting, recommendation, and document intelligence prototypes using leading no-code tools. Module 3 covers advanced prompt design including chain-of-thought reasoning, role prompting, contextual anchoring, and prompt debugging aligned with 2024–2025 LLM best practices. Module 4 focuses on testing, validating, and deploying your prototypes into real business workflows.
